Understanding a Complete Blood Count (CBC)
A standard CBC is a common blood test that measures:
- Red Blood Cells (RBCs): Carry oxygen throughout the body.
- White Blood Cells (WBCs): Fight infections and are important for the immune system.
- Platelets: Small cell fragments that help with blood clotting.
What is a Differential?
The term "differential" refers to a breakdown of the different types of white blood cells. These include:
- Neutrophils: Primarily fight bacterial infections.
- Lymphocytes: Involved in viral infections and immune responses.
- Monocytes: Fight infection, and also help remove dead or damaged tissues.
- Eosinophils: Combat parasitic infections and involved in allergic reactions.
- Basophils: Involved in allergic reactions and inflammation.

CBC with Differential Platelets Explained
While the term "differential" typically applies to white blood cell types, in the context of 'CBC with differential platelets' it often refers to more detailed analysis of platelets themselves. This can include:
- Platelet count: The total number of platelets in your blood.
- Mean Platelet Volume (MPV): Measures the average size of platelets. Variations in MPV can indicate certain conditions.
- Platelet Distribution Width (PDW): Measures the variability in platelet sizes.
- Immature Platelet Fraction (IPF): Measures the amount of newly released platelets in the blood.
